Features and Benefits of Multisystem Smart TV

Different countries support different types of television standards: NTSC, PAL, or SECAM. The NTSC acronym stands for National Television Standards Committee, and this standard was developed in the USA. It is one of the oldest standards available with picture resolutions of 720 x 480, 704 x 480, 352 x 240 and 352 x 480. Some countries that also use this standard include the Netherlands, Columbia, Ecuador, Honduras, Japan, Mexico, the Philippines, and Taiwan. Meanwhile PAL (which stands for Phase Alternating Line) was developed in the UK and Germany. Countries using this standard include China, India, Germany, Jordan, Malaysia, the Maldives, Singapore, Thailand, the UK and the UAE. The last standard is SECAM, which means Sequential Couleur a Memoire. It was developed in France. Mauritius, Monaco, Morocco, Greece, Haiti, Hungary, Vietnam and Iran are some of the countries using this standard.
